Reduce delays in Further Leave to Remain (Family and Private life) applications for parents of British children and partners. Some families have waited over 12 months despite paying £5,000+ including for the Immigration Health Surcharge and usually having no access to public funds.

Delays can harm jobs, businesses, mental health and children’s welfare. We want the Government to set an 8-week maximum decision time with automatic priority processing for family cases. With no access to public funds, delays can affect work, businesses, housing, mental health and children’s wellbeing. We believe British children should not suffer because a parent’s application is delayed.
